DAY 25: Cue The Magic

The Universe provides us with daily reminders of things to be grateful for. Being aware of these signs is what today's practice is all about. After years of doing yoga your intuitive nature is heightened and awareness of environment becomes second nature. They say that a practice like yoga teaches us the art of listening. Today your going to take everything you've learned on your mat so that you can cue the magic even more in your life.

When someone wishes you 'good morning', that is your cue to be thankful for a just that - 'A good start to the day'. The moment you hear the kettle whistle, that is a reminder to give thanks for hot water. As you walk by your bank, this is your cue to be grateful for the money you have. The sound of a car horn reminds you of your safety, so say 'Thank you' for being safe! Sometimes we literally see signs on the storefront windows that remind us of Love, To Breathe and Stay Calm. Giving thanks to all these beautiful traits can uplift you in a heartbeat.

To play Cue the Magic, you just have to be alert enough to recognize the messages from the Universe. The more awareness you are to the blessings in your life it accelerates your dreams into reality


Magic Practice #25 Cue The Magic

1. Count your blessings. Make a list of 10 blessings. Write WHY you're grateful. Reread your list, and at the end of each blessing say, Thank you, thank you, thank you (3x), and feel as grateful for that blessing as you can.

2. Today, be alert to what's around you, and take at least 7 gratitude cues from the events in your day. For example, if you see someone who is being active and staying healthy, say 'Thank you for my perfect health'


3. Before you go to sleep, take your magic rock in one hand and say the magic words, Thank you, for the best thing that happened during the day.
